In the book, dawkins argues against the watchmaker analogy made famous by the eighteenthcentury english theologian william paley via his book natural theology, in which paley argues that just as a watch is too complicated and too functional to have sprung into existence merely by accident, so too must all living thingswith their far greater complexitybe purposefully designed. Richard dawkins taught zoology at the university of california at berkeley and at oxford university and is now the charles simonyi professor of the public understanding of science at oxford, a position he has held since 1995.
